So, 'The Butt' is this quirky little gem from 1974 that dives into the world of a young boy, Johan, who’s just crazy about football. The film captures that innocent joy of childhood mixed with the pressures of growing up too fast. It’s a blend of comedy and drama that feels very genuine, almost like a snapshot of simpler times. The pacing isn’t too frantic, allowing the viewer to soak in the moments – especially those where Fimpen navigates the media circus. The performances, particularly from the young lead, have this raw charm that makes it all the more relatable. Plus, the practical effects and the way they depict Johan's transition from a carefree kid to a local idol is quite distinctive.
The film has had limited releases over the years, making original prints somewhat scarce in collector circles. Though it may not be on everyone’s radar, those who appreciate vintage family films with a European touch often seek it out. Its charm lies in the simplicity of its storytelling and the nostalgia it evokes, appealing to a niche audience who enjoys exploring lesser-known titles from the 70s.
